About the compound:

2,2-Dimethylbutane, commonly known as neohexane, is an organic compound with the chemical formula C6H14. It is an alkane and is the most compact and highly branched isomer of hexane. Neohexane is unique among hexane isomers due to its quaternary carbon atom and a butane (C4) backbone.

Physical Description

Neohexane is a colorless liquid with an odor of gasoline. Less dense than water and insoluble in water. Hence floats on water. Irritating vapor. Flash point -54 °F.

Boiling Point

121.5 °F at 760 mmHg (NTP, 1992)

Melting Point

-148 °F (NTP, 1992)

Density

0.649 at 68 °F (USCG, 1999)

Solubility 

less than 1 mg/mL at 72 °F (NTP, 1992)

Vapor Pressure

274 mmHg at 70 °F ; 400 mmHg at 87.8 °F (NTP, 1992)
